VEHICLE SPEED CONTROL - ACCELERATOR PEDAL
08/21/2007380001
 Stepped on gas pedal and it stuck causing acceleration. eventually slowed down. upon inspection by mechanic, it was found that a spring on gas pedal had become dislodged. one end of the spring is straight (like a pin) and it had stuck into the floor carpet, eventually releasing itself. this is a faulty design and very dangerous. gm has been notified and the vehicle was inspected by chevrolet dealer but they will not do anything about it. this could get someone killed. *tr
